Output e561661b2c1c03dfb68d1648520f63c23462e61eaba62c1b50cf45fa830a5c39:1

value
501986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c87a12738b8c82cf91a488ecba43445c1fe3793 OP_EQUAL
address
3BasNxuHhuBh5TvAq3mVCsYQ9Zh7CVwKvk
transaction
e561661b2c1c03dfb68d1648520f63c23462e61eaba62c1b50cf45fa830a5c39
confirmations
237084
spent
true